Graves vandalised, objects stolen at Dromolaxia cemetery

Vandals caused damage to graves, from which objects were stolen, at the Dromolaxia Cemetery.

The perpetrators damaged small chapels that were placed on graves and snatched valuables intended to honour the deceased, while breaking vases and other objects.

The case is being investigated by the Police, as mentioned to philenews by the Mayor of Dromolaxia-Meneou, Kypros Andronikou.

“We unequivocally condemn the desecration of graves and will take specific measures,” Andronikou stated, noting that lighting will be installed, and the cemetery will be closed from 7 in the evening.

The incident caused great distress to the relatives, who were confronted with a gruesome sight when they rushed to the cemetery to visit the graves of their loved ones.
